We are looking for an inspiring discovery scientist to drive innovation and development of our pioneering lentiviral vector therapeutic platform. Join us in shaping the future of cell and gene therapy with your expertise in viral vector engineering, gene editing, CAR and TCR T cell engineering or myeloid immunobiology in cancer. Accountabilities Independently design, plan and execute research development studies for the establishment and advancement of the product pipeline at EsoBiotec. Design and optimize new lentiviral vectors for in vivo gene therapy. Manufacture, characterize, and evaluate new lentiviral vectors in vitro and in vivo models. Coordinate studies with other team members, analyze and present data internally and externally to collaborators as needed. Execute research timelines to meet program and corporate objectives. Manage external stakeholders (research institutes/centers, suppliers, and service providers) and represent the company externally at scientific conferences. Essential Skills/Experience PhD degree in Immunology, Molecular/Cell Biology, Biochemistry or Virology with a minimum 4-year post doc or industry experience required. Strong academic or industry research background and track record of the following area is a must: ​- Viral vector engineering Strong scientific/technical writing and communication skills in English is required. Excellent organization and data analysis skills are a must. Ability to multi-task in a fast-paced environment with changing priorities while meeting project objectives on schedule. Autonomous, must be able to work independently with minimal supervision. Should be self-motivated, detail-oriented, flexible, and have a “do-what-it-takes” attitude. Excellent oral and written communication skills in English. Desirable Skills/Experience Strong preference for lentiviral vectors.
